Important information:
When we are unfortunately unable to check you in
Should we be unable to check you in, we will inform you so that you can check in yourself.
When and why this happens:
- If you are flying with Ryanair
Ryanair does not allow us direct access to your booking or check-in details
If we require additional documents or details
- Flights to the USA: Check-in for the outbound flight is only possible with a full destination address
- Airlines that require copies or scans of passports (e.g. United Airlines, American Airlines).
- Check-ins requiring SMS verification, e.g. Chinese airlines
- Check-ins requiring visa or residence permit details
- If you are a guest traveller
Due to legal requirements, we are not permitted to check in guest travellers
- If you have booked alongside a colleague whom we cannot check in (guest traveller, missing passport details for colleagues, etc.)
In the case of a joint booking, for technical reasons all travellers usually have to be checked in together.
- If you book at short notice (less than 2 hours before departure)
Most airlines do not allow third parties to check in at such short notice.
- If you book at night (8.00 pm–8.00 am) for the following day (particularly early flights before 10.00 am), we cannot guarantee timely check-in and ask that you check in yourself.
Further information
- If you have booked separately from your colleagues, we will check you in individually and are therefore unable to guarantee that you will be seated together.
- We will attempt to check you in once check-in opens. If this is not possible – for example, due to missing passport details – we will not attempt to do so again even after the passport details have been uploaded.
